Compare Lincoln University and Abraham Lincoln University

Both Lincoln University and Abraham Lincoln University are 4 years schools located in California. The following statements compare Lincoln University and Abraham Lincoln University with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Lincoln's tuition ($13,150) is more expensive than Abraham Lincoln ($10,440).
  • Abraham Lincoln's students to faculty ratio (2 to 1) is lower than Lincoln (15 to 1).
  • Lincoln (436 students) is larger than Abraham Lincoln (112 students) with more enrolled students.
  • Abraham Lincoln ($5,455) has higher amount of financial aid than Lincoln ($4,963).
  • Both schools have same graduation rate of 100%.
